> With the random merge, can /dev/(u)random devices now be added to
> MAKEDEV?
Yes.
> (I'm not married to the seed file argument, in case there is a
> better default location for it.)
For the record, Debian uses /var/spool/random-seed.
> + random)
> + st $I root 644 /hurd/random --secure --seed-file /var/lib/random-=
seed;;
But --secure doesn't seem to work yet, aiui we lack entropy sources.
The Debian package however contains a patch to make --fast the
default. You could drop --secure, as it is the default in the stock
sources, and will be in the Debian package once this issue is
addressed.
